Mapping digit-representations in BA3b during stimulation and investigating their intrinsic connectivity at rest using VASO

While inter-digit interactions are crucial for manual abilities like tool use or object manipulation, individual digits seem to be distinctly represented in the primary somatosensory cortex. Here, we used cortical depth-resolved high-resolution CBV-measurements to investigate these representations in the putative S1-subregion “BA3b” and depth-dependent temporal correlation during rest, as a potential index for layer-specific integration between digit representations. We found that we can

  1. identify individual digit-representations in human subjects during stimulation using VASO
  2. show more specific depth profiles for VASO than BOLD
  3. see intrinsic interactions between digits at rest, which might be driven by deep-to-deep layer connections
